The River Tib The River Tib has been hidden from view for almost two centuries, and yet is still remembered in place names such as Tib Street, Tib Lock, Tib Lane. It marked the boundary of the Roman settlement Mamucium and ultimately feeds the River Medlock. History and information about heat pump ... The first heat pump as we know it today was built by Peter von Rittinger in 1856. He recognised the principle of the heat pump while conducting experiments on the use of water vapour's latent heat for the evaporation of salt brine. As a result, in Austria the heat pump was used to dry salt in salt marshes.
